This was a pretty exciting challenge to do. I started off with plain ivory, green and kraft cardstock. Then out came a variety of Tattered Angels Glimmer mists, distress ink and some stamps. Presto my own home made DP's.
My paper had an old vintage feel to it so I distressed just about anything I got my hands on. I even colored my bias binding and lace with the Glimmer Mist. Perfect match!!! In case you haven't noticed this is a book card that I constructed with watercolor paper.
I searched through my stash of stamps and came across this "Dreamer" and that's what I named my book. Easy Peasy!!
